Increasingly complex industrial control systems objectively demand networked control system which is the inevitable trend of control field. In this paper, the researching work is from the aspect of network scheduling and control co-design in networked control system. To decrease the bad effectiveness of the control system's stability and the control performance which are caused by network-induced delay, etc, the main research contents are as follows.(1)Learning of the simulation platform, the function modules and system implementation processes which based on the TrueTime toolbox have been carefully studied in this paper. The TrueTime toolbox can comprehensively reflect both control properties and network transmission characteristics. DC motors were choosen as the controlled objects, a multi-loop networked control systems were built up based on the platform which was a foundation for experimental study in this paper. And two kinds of classic scheduling algorithms-RM and EDF were analyzed.(2)For resource-constrained networked control system, a variable sampling period scheduler based on Levinson-Durbin algorithm was proposed. The scheduler real-time and online monitored the network resources, it achieved dynamically allocation of the resources by adjusted the sampling periods according to the network resources demanding of the control loops. Experimental results showed that the scheduler could ensure the stability of the control system. And most of the time, network-induced delay of the system owned the variable sampling period scheduler was less than the system with the fixed sampling periods in the same environment, this illustrated that the scheduler could effectively reduce network-induced delay.(3)To ensure the stability of the NCS that works in the uncertain and variable loads environment which means besides the control system nodes, there are other applications using the network resources uncertainly, this paper also presented a strategy of variable sampling periods based on support vector machine that faced the multiple-input and multiple output systems. Comparing with the former research, the strategy has considered the couping of the sampling periods and it is close to the real system. Experimental results showed that comparing with the fixed sampling period system, the strategy made the networked control systems which worked on the condition of dynamic loads always operate stable. The system runned 10s, the total IAE of the fixed sampling periods' system was infinite, while the system with the variable sampling period strategy, total IAE was 9.791, this demonstrated that the strategy can improve the overall control performance, besides that, it also can raise the schedulability of the network.
